Effect of doxycycline intervention on the apoptosis as well as the IL-1, TNF-α and HIF-1α expression in cornea and aqueous humor in rats with corneal alkali burn

摘要

Objective:To study the effect of doxycycline intervention on the apoptosis as well as the IL-1, TNF-α and HIF-1α expression in cornea and aqueous humor in rats with corneal alkali burn.Methods: Male SD rats were selected as experimental animals and randomly divided into control group, alkali burn group and doxycycline group, corneal alkali burn models were established by sodium hydroxide eye drop and then they received doxycycline eye drops intervention. The expression of apoptosis molecules, inflammatory response cytokines and angiogenesis moleculesin the cornea as well as the expression of inflammatory response cytokines and angiogenesis molecules in aqueous humor were detected 14 and 28 d after model establishment.Results: 14 and 28 d after model establishment, Bcl-2 and PEDF protein expression in cornea tissue of alkali burn group were significantly lower than those of control group while Caspase-3, Caspase-8, Caspase-9, IL-1, TNF-α, HIF-1α and VEGF protein expression were significantly higher than those of control group; Bcl-2 and PEDF protein expression in cornea tissue of doxycycline group were significantly higher than those of alkali burn group while Caspase-3, Caspase-8, Caspase-9, IL-1, TNF-α, HIF-1α and VEGF protein expression were significantly lower than those of alkali burn group.Conclusion: Doxycycline for corneal alkali burn intervention can inhibit the apoptosis, inflammatory response and angiogenesis.
